Context Window
Maximum input and output token capacity
Only Gemini 2.5 Flash-Lite specifies input context (1,048,576 tokens). Only Gemini 2.5 Flash-Lite specifies output context (65,536 tokens).
Input Capabilities
Supported data types and modalities
Gemini 2.5 Flash-Lite supports multimodal inputs, whereas Llama 3.1 Nemotron Ultra 253B v1 does not.
Gemini 2.5 Flash-Lite can handle both text and other forms of data like images, making it suitable for multimodal applications.

Release Timeline
When each model was launched
Gemini 2.5 Flash-Lite was released on 2025-06-17, while Llama 3.1 Nemotron Ultra 253B v1 was released on 2025-04-07.
Gemini 2.5 Flash-Lite is 2 months newer than Llama 3.1 Nemotron Ultra 253B v1.

Knowledge Cutoff
When training data ends
Gemini 2.5 Flash-Lite has a knowledge cutoff of 2025-01-01, while Llama 3.1 Nemotron Ultra 253B v1 has a cutoff of 2023-12-01.
Gemini 2.5 Flash-Lite has more recent training data (up to 2025-01-01), making it potentially better informed about events through that date compared to Llama 3.1 Nemotron Ultra 253B v1 (2023-12-01).
